Uploaded image for project: 'OpenShift Bugs'
  1. OpenShift Bugs
  2. OCPBUGS-4960

Topology sidebar actions doesn't show the latest resource data

    XMLWordPrintable

Details

    • Important
    • Rejected
    • False
    • Hide

      None

      Show
      None
    • Hide
      Cause: The topology sidebar doesn't watch resources for changes and the information when the sidebar has opened. Actions, modals, displayed labels, and annotations use not up-to-date information.

      Consequence: The out-dated information could confuse users esp. when they update the resource directly from the sidebar and the shown information doesn't reflect the change. The user needs to close and reopen the topology sidebar to see the latest data.

      Fix: Watch for resource updates as the topology and other list and detail pages do.

      Result: The user sees the latest changes directly in the sidebar. Changing content from modals or triggering actions works based on the latest data and isn't confusing anymore.
      Show
      Cause: The topology sidebar doesn't watch resources for changes and the information when the sidebar has opened. Actions, modals, displayed labels, and annotations use not up-to-date information. Consequence: The out-dated information could confuse users esp. when they update the resource directly from the sidebar and the shown information doesn't reflect the change. The user needs to close and reopen the topology sidebar to see the latest data. Fix: Watch for resource updates as the topology and other list and detail pages do. Result: The user sees the latest changes directly in the sidebar. Changing content from modals or triggering actions works based on the latest data and isn't confusing anymore.
    • Bug Fix

    Description

      Description of problem:
      This is a follow up on OCPBUGSM-47202 (https://bugzilla.redhat.com/show_bug.cgi?id=2110570)

      While OCPBUGSM-47202 fixes the issue specific for Set Pod Count, many other actions aren't fixed. When the user updates a Deployment with one of this options, and selects the action again, the old values are still shown.

      Version-Release number of selected component (if applicable)
      4.8-4.12 as well as master with the changes of OCPBUGSM-47202

      How reproducible:
      Always

      Steps to Reproduce:

      1. Import a deployment
      2. Select the deployment to open the topology sidebar
      3. Click on actions and one of the 4 options to update the deployment with a modal
        1. Edit labels
        2. Edit annotatations
        3. Edit update strategy
        4. Edit resource limits
      4. Click on the action again and check if the data in the modal reflects the changes from step 3

      Actual results:
      Old data (labels, annotations, etc.) was shown.

      Expected results:
      Latest data should be shown

      Additional info:

      Attachments

        Issue Links

          Activity

            People

              cjerolim Christoph Jerolimov
              cjerolim Christoph Jerolimov
              Sanket Pathak Sanket Pathak
              Red Hat Employee
              Votes:
              0 Vote for this issue
              Watchers:
              7 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ved: